A population of CD4(hi)CD38(hi) T cells correlates with disease severity in patients with acute malaria
OBJECTIVE: CD4(+) T cells are critical mediators of immunity to Plasmodium spp. infection, but their characteristics during malarial episodes and immunopathology in naturally infected adults are poorly defined.
